Community Family Centers Launches Construction Training Program

Starting Monday, May 14, Community Family Centers in the historic East End of Houston will begin offering training for people to earn nationally recognized certifications in construction.

Our partners at Community Family Centers help people throughout that area in a number of ways, and this is a new frontier for them. 

From the announcement: 

“Earn & Learn with CFC while training for Three Nationally Recognized Credentials in the Construction Industry. Participants can train for OSHA 10, NCCER Core, NCCER Drywall Level 1 (Carpentry & Commercial Roofing) and have On-the-Job Training with area Construction Companies. Trainees can also prepare for the GED and learn about Post-Secondary pathways."

The training includes instruction to improve math and reading as they relate to construction. The program represents a unique collaboration of organizations aligned toward a common mission of selecting, preparing, educating and helping people to find a fulfilling livelihood in construction.
